I bought my 2012 F150 FX4 Ecoboost brand new in February
I bought my 2012 F150 FX4 Ecoboost brand new in February 2012. I currently have 64k miles on it. I have never had a mechanical issue with it. Regular preventative maintenance has kept it very reliable. It has a comfortable and quiet ride for a truck. I have towed 3 different campers with it ranging from 5k-8k pounds. The Ecoboost easily handles the towing with plenty of HP and torque. Just don't expect great gas mileage while towing, 7-9mph. Without towing on the highway, I can average 19mph. For a half ton truck, I tow my 35ft camper with no concerns. It's a comfortable commuter truck too. I love my truck!

2011 Expedition XLT - Very Reliable
I've owned my 2011 Expedition XLT regular wheelbase since 2012 (leftover). Basic cloth seats, manual A/C and heavy duty towing. This SUV has been super reliable. Preventative maintenance and I do all myself. Oil at 5k using Ford blend 5-20 for 100k and now 5-30. 3rd set of plugs and 2nd set of coils. This is the brown plug boot engine which I believe all 2008+ Expeditions use. Trans fluid changed at 60k, 110k and now ready. Front brakes have been replaced many times as it's just the way these brake. No problem as I do it myself but some may not like this. Liftgate the usual paint peeling and I don't care. Hood also has some under the front and think the bug shield has prevented it from peeling in the top of the hood. I just added a nice touchcreen with back up camera since the green LED radio got real dim. I plan on driving this one for another couple yrs and up to at least 200k. It appears the 2010-12 are overall very reliable and since they have a steep depreciation, not bad to pick one up. Not IF AND ONLY IF the oil was maintained with proper and FREQUENT oil changes! The 2008+ Ford 5.4L 3Valve in general is a decent engine ONLY IF THE OIL has been changed!!! If not, set aside $7k for an engine swap.

Which Ford vehicle has the best MPG?
The Ford Fusion Hybrid can reach up to 43 MPG city and 41 MPG highway for a combined rating of 42 MPG. The Ford Maverick with traditional internal combustion engine offers up to 42 MPG city and 35 MPG highway for a combined rating of 38 MPG.
These figures are based on EPA mileage ratings and are for comparison purposes only. The actual mileage will vary depending on the selected vehicle model year, trim, driving conditions, driving habits, vehicle maintenance, and other factors.
Which Ford vehicle has the longest range?
The electric Ford F-150 Lightning can travel up to 320 miles on a single charge depending on electric motor and battery options. The plug-in hybrid Ford Escape PHEV can travel up to 37 electric-only miles before the gas engine kicks on.
EPA-estimated range is the distance, or predicted distance, a new plug-in vehicle will travel on electric power before its battery charge is exhausted. Actual range will vary depending on model year, driving conditions, driving habits, elevation changes, weather, accessory usage (lights, climate control), vehicle condition and other factors.
